Inclusive Entrepreneurship APPG

First Registered: 07/08/2020 • Last updated on: 01/11/2023

Note: This APPG was last registered on 1st November 2023. The APPG was not registered in the latest release of the 24th January 2024 and may be defunct.

To ensure that Parliament is fully informed on what is needed to create and sustain the most beneficial conditions for inclusive economic growth. To stimulate, encourage and nurture inclusive entrepreneurship throughout the country, and to engage with entrepreneurs who have protected characteristics, particularly disabled entrepreneurs.

Note: All-Party Parliamentary Groups (APPGs) are informal, cross-party groups formed by MPs and Members of the House of Lords who share a common interest in a particular policy area, region or country. APPGs have no official status within Parliament.
